#include "DistrhoPlugin.hpp"

START_NAMESPACE_DISTRHO

// -----------------------------------------------------------------------------------------------------------

/**
  Plugin that demonstrates the basic API in DPF.
 */
class GainExamplePlugin : public Plugin
{
public:
    GainExamplePlugin()
        : Plugin(1, 0, 0), // 1 parameter
          fGain(1.0)
    {
    }

    ~GainExamplePlugin() override
    {
    }

protected:
   /* --------------------------------------------------------------------------------------------------------
    * Information */

   /**
      Get the plugin label.
      This label is a short restricted name consisting of only _, a-z, A-Z and 0-9 characters.
    */
    const char* getLabel() const override
    {
        return "Gain";
    }

   /**
      Get an extensive comment/description about the plugin.
    */
    const char* getDescription() const override
    {
        return "Plugin that demonstrates the basic API in DPF.";
    }

   /**
      Get the plugin author/maker.
    */
    const char* getMaker() const override
    {
        return "DISTRHO";
    }

   /**
      Get the plugin homepage.
    */
    const char* getHomePage() const override
    {
        return "https://github.com/DISTRHO/DPF";
    }

   /**
      Get the plugin license name (a single line of text).
      For commercial plugins this should return some short copyright information.
    */
    const char* getLicense() const override
    {
        return "ISC";
    }

   /**
      Get the plugin version, in hexadecimal.
    */
    uint32_t getVersion() const override
    {
        return d_version(1, 0, 0);
    }

   /**
      Get the plugin unique Id.
      This value is used by LADSPA, DSSI and VST plugin formats.
    */
    int64_t getUniqueId() const override
    {
        return d_cconst('d', 'G', 'a', 'i');
    }

   /* --------------------------------------------------------------------------------------------------------
    * Init */

   /**
      Initialize the parameter @a index.
      This function will be called once, shortly after the plugin is created.
    */
    void initParameter(uint32_t index, Parameter& parameter) override
    {
        if (index != 0)
            return;

        parameter.hints  = kParameterIsAutomable;
        parameter.name   = "Gain";
        parameter.symbol = "gain";
        parameter.ranges.def = 1.0f;
        parameter.ranges.min = 0.0f;
        parameter.ranges.max = 2.0f;

        d_stdout("initParameter %u", index);
    }

   /* --------------------------------------------------------------------------------------------------------
    * Internal data */

   /**
      Get the current value of a parameter.
      The host may call this function from any context, including realtime processing.
    */
    float getParameterValue(uint32_t index) const override
    {
        d_stdout("getParameterValue %u %f", index, fGain);
        if (index != 0)
            return 0.0f;

        return fGain;
    }

   /**
      Change a parameter value.
      The host may call this function from any context, including realtime processing.
      When a parameter is marked as automable, you must ensure no non-realtime operations are performed.
      @note This function will only be called for parameter inputs.
    */
    void setParameterValue(uint32_t index, float value) override
    {
        d_stdout("setParameterValue %u %f", index, value);
        if (index != 0)
            return;

        fGain = value;
    }

   /* --------------------------------------------------------------------------------------------------------
    * Audio/MIDI Processing */

   /**
      Run/process function for plugins without MIDI input.
      @note Some parameters might be null if there are no audio inputs or outputs.
    */
    void run(const float** inputs, float** outputs, uint32_t frames) override
    {
        const float* const in  = inputs[0];
        /* */ float* const out = outputs[0];

        for (uint32_t i = 0; i < frames; i++) {
            out[i] = in[i] * fGain;
        }
    }

    // -------------------------------------------------------------------------------------------------------

private:
    // Parameters
    float fGain;

   /**
      Set our plugin class as non-copyable and add a leak detector just in case.
    */
    DISTRHO_DECLARE_NON_COPYABLE_WITH_LEAK_DETECTOR(GainExamplePlugin)
};

/* ------------------------------------------------------------------------------------------------------------
 * Plugin entry point, called by DPF to create a new plugin instance. */

Plugin* createPlugin()
{
    return new GainExamplePlugin();
}

// -----------------------------------------------------------------------------------------------------------

END_NAMESPACE_DISTRHO
